Rocco Resurfaces
It has been weeks since Rocco (Finn Carr) left town with Britt and his fake passport. Through Charlotte (Bluesy Burke), he got word to Lulu (Alexa Havins) and Dante (Dominic Zamprogna, who’s loving the material that he’s been getting lately) that he was safe. But other than that, nothing. Brick (Stephen A. Smith) has been out there trying to track them down on Sonny’s request. But apparently, Britt’s fugitive skills are expert, and they haven’t been caught as of yet.
However, Rocco’s about to make a horrifying discovery. GH’s weekly video preview shows an unconscious Britt (Kelly Thiebaud). We don’t know why or how. It could mean her Huntington’s symptoms are back in full force. Leaving town meant being cut off from the meds that kept those symptoms at bay. This emergency situation means that Rocco has to make a desperate phone call for help. Who does he call? Is life on the road suddenly over?
Sidwell Sets a Trap
Someone else living their best fugitive life is Sidwell (Carlo Rota). Ever since he shot Lucas (Van Hansis) point-blank in the chest (thankfully, he wore a bulletproof vest), the shady businessman has been on the run. Cassius ensured his escape, and now the crime lord is about to make a move of his own. He lays a trap. Who does he hope will walk right into it?
Dante Confides in Elizabeth
Dante is getting it from all sides professionally and personally. He has to deal with a relentless Justine (Nazneen Contractor) while Chase (Josh Swickard) continues to take Willow’s side, and “Nathan” (Ryan Paevey) lies about who he is and what he’s done, including letting Sidwell escape. Meanwhile, one of his sons is a fugitive after Lulu secured a fake passport and had her own plans to take Rocco on the run without Dante.
There are two positive aspects to his life right now. He’s getting along with Gio (Giovanni Mazza) — the two are growing closer. And there’s his connection with Elizabeth (Rebecca Herbst). The two have been supporting each other more and more these days. So it should be no surprise to anyone that he will once again confide in Elizabeth on Thursday.
Sonny Strategizes with Ric
While Laura (Genie Francis) makes an offer, Sonny (Maurice Benard) shares his strategy with Ric (Rick Hearst, who reveals why Ric is finally worth taking a chance on). This strategy could involve a plan to tackle their continued Sidwell problem. Sonny did his best to set a trap for Sidwell. And it worked…until it didn’t. And now the vicious criminal is out there, and he needs to be dealt with. Whatever Sonny’s strategy involves, Ric will be honest with his brother as to whether the plan is viable.
